Output 83390fe47556ce622ddbd309f9e5021124c86efacc8e85fa67b38d211f5f5a91:23

value
2309642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492b9f59f1608c4a1d2749fed7dc6dd75225c23c OP_EQUAL
address
38MuWVLo9rN6Dmo3UTWJFodAke1756YDeS
transaction
83390fe47556ce622ddbd309f9e5021124c86efacc8e85fa67b38d211f5f5a91
spent
true